10 Nov, 2025FY25 performance highlights
Reported FY25 Group EBITDA reached $38.4m, with underlying operating cash flow of $31.1m before refinancing and acquisition costs.
Unaudited underlying earnings grew by 8.2% for FY25.
Acquisitions of DVL & Kobe contributed positively to the commercial security segment.
Installation and new customer revenue pipeline expanded to $36.6m by period end, up from $0m at ADT acquisition.
Launched ADT Guard, an AI-driven perimeter security solution with direct police response.
Post-period developments and pipeline
Deliverable pipeline increased by 24% in early FY26, reaching $45.5m.
Acquired Western Advance for $4.5m, enhancing expertise in the Oil & Gas sector and WA operations.
Acquired BNP Securities to support scaling of ADT Guard in commercial and enterprise markets.
Reviewing ADT Care NZ business as 3G rollout concludes, with updates expected by year-end.
FY26 outlook and guidance
FY26 underlying EBITDA is forecast between $43-47m, representing 12-24% growth over FY25.
Growth depends on pipeline delivery timing, reinvestment decisions for ADT Guard, and outcomes of the NZ Medical business review.
